Overview

The goal of this study is to characterize an electroencephalogram (EEG) biomarker for fentanyl and understand where this signal is coming from in the brain. The investigators also aim to understand how this EEG biomarker is connected to patient perception to drug liking.

Interventions

  • Other Observational study in patients receiving fentanyl for surgery
    This observational study enrolls patients receiving fentanyl, a drug routinely administered during surgery under general anesthesia. The primary difference in the investigators' research protocol is the inclusion of a 5-minute interval between fentanyl administration and the induction of general anesthesia. Primary outcome measures

  • Source Localization of Fentanyl EEG Signature [Time frame: 15 minutes prior to surgery]
Secondary outcome measures (2)
  • Relationship Between Fentanyl EEG Signature and Fentanyl Effect Site Concentration [Time frame: 15 minutes prior to surgery]
  • Relationship Between Visual Analog Scale Liking Rating and Fentanyl EEG Signature [Time frame: 15 minutes before the surgery]

Eligibility criteria

Inclusion criteria

  • 18 years old or above (male and female)
  • American Society of Anesthesiologists (ASA) physical status classification of I, II or III
  • Candidates scheduled for general surgical procedures under general anesthesia and receive fentanyl for surgery

Exclusion criteria

  • Craniofacial abnormalities
  • Known or suspected difficult intubation or mask ventilation
  • Known or suspected need for rapid sequence induction and intubation
  • Body mass index above 45 kg/m2
  • Allergies to fentanyl
  • History of obstructive sleep apnea requiring CPAP
  • History of obstructive or restrictive lung disease
  • Opiate use within 24 hours
  • History of opiate abuse within the last 3 years
  • Known or suspected severe chronic pain condition that require use of opiates or limit daily activities
  • MRI contraindications, such as presence of pacemakers, aneurysm clips, artificial heart valves, ear implants, metal fragments, or foreign objects in the eyes, skin, or body
